Animated information from NOAA's Global Forecasting System on the expected air temperature at an altitude of about 1500 m.
During the cold half of the year a light blue line plots the minus 5°C isotherm. North of this line, precipitation is very likely to be snow, south of it, rain.
In the warm half of the year a red line draws the plus 20°C isotherm. South of it it gets hot during the day with temperatures above 35°C.
Cold air masses are represented by colours from blue to purple, and warm air masses—by colours from yellow to red.
